Leaves and Lizards is a nice family run accommodation in the hills overlooking Arenal Volcano. It is somewhat of a trek into the tourist town of La Fortuna, but with a rental car it is easily manageable. It is worth doing taking the 25 minute drive for the view that you get. It overlooks the volcano and has an amazing view. Unfortunately it was mostly cloudy when we were there and it took us a few days to see the volcano. When we did see it, it wasn’t active, but that is just bad luck on our side I guess. Should you go to Leaves and Lizards and have clear skies and an active volcano then it would be an amazing sight. Steve and Debbie the owners of Leaves and lizards are very friendly and will help plan any excursions you might be interested in. I especially like the Cano Negro tour with Giovanni who is an excellent guide. The accommodation itself is a private cabin which overlooks the volcano and also an area of land that Steve and Debbie are reforesting. There are already some mature fruit trees, which were regularly visited by Toucans whilst we were there. There are also some nice flowers planted near the cabins which were frequented by humming birds. I could not fault the accommodation or the location. However as a wildlife photographer I was generally disappointed, with the Arenal area, except for the Cano Negro tour. I imagine it does offer some great landscape opportunities though, especially when the volcano is active. It is also a family destination and there are numerous activities available in the surrounding area.
